How much do bank customer service rep j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 25, 2026, the average hourly pay for bank customer service rep in Virginia is $18.64,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.24 and $20.72 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some common challenges faced by Bank Customer Service Representatives, and how can they be addressed?

Bank Customer Service Representatives often encounter challenges such as handling difficult customer inquiries, managing high transaction volumes, and staying updated with evolving banking regulations. To address these challenges, it's helpful to develop strong communication and problem-solving skills, and to take advantage of ongoing training offered by most banks. Additionally, collaborating closely with team members allows for knowledge sharing and support, making it easier to resolve complex issues efficiently and maintain positive customer relationships.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Bank Customer Service Rep,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Bank Customer Service Rep, you need strong customer service skills, attention to detail, and basic knowledge of banking products, typically sup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with banking software, CRM systems, and cash handling procedures is commonly required. Excellent communication, problem-solving, and patience help build trust and effectively address customer concerns. These skills are essential for ensuring customer satisfaction, accuracy in transactions, and maintaining the bank's reputation.

What does a Bank Customer Service Rep do?

A Bank Customer Service Representative assists customers with their banking needs, such as opening and closing accounts, processing transactions, answering questions about products and services, and resolving any issues or concerns. They also handle inquiries related to account balances, loans, and credit cards, and may help customers with online banking or fraud prevention. Bank Customer Service Reps play a key role in ensuring a positive customer experience and maintaining the bank's reputation.

POSITION SUMMARY:
The Customer Service Representative performs bank office activities including receiving deposits, processing checks, disbursing funds and verifying the accuracy of transactions. This position identifies and capitalizes on opportunities to refer new banking products and services to the appropriate business partner. The Customer Service Representative reports to the Office Manager and provides excellent service and support to customers and team members, while demonstrating the Company's values and supporting the mission.
POSITION D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
  • Perform bank office activities to include providing service and support to customers, receiving deposits, processing checks, disbursing funds and verifying the accuracy of transactions
  • Guard against loss by ensuring safekeeping of money in cash drawer and prompt accounting or transfer of funds. Identify fraudulent activity.
  • Enter transactions in bank's recordkeeping system, recording all transactions and producing customer receipt
  • Perform teller capture duties
  • Balance cash drawer at end of shift
  • Maintain a work area that protects all negotiables and confidential records
  • Develop and grow knowledge of new and existing products and services
  • Assist customers with account-related issues or concerns, recognizing when escalation is needed to improve the customer experience
  • Identify and capitalize on opportunities to refer banking products and services to the appropriate business partner
  • Adhere to compliance with all federal bank regulations and laws, including those for consumer protection and the Bank Secrecy Act/Anti-Money Laundering Program
  • Attend training as requested
  • Participate in outside community activities as required
  • Perform other duties as assigned
